Acquired reversible autistic syndrome in acute encephalopathic illness in children

Insights

This study presents three children who developed reversible autistic syndrome during an acute illness, suggesting a link to medial temporal lobe disease. This acquired condition highlights potential neurological underpinnings of childhood autism.

Area of Science:

  • Neurology
  • Developmental Psychology
  • Pediatrics

Background:

  • Previous research suggested medial temporal lobe or mesolimbic cortex involvement in childhood autism.
  • Understanding the neurological basis of autistic syndromes is crucial for diagnosis and treatment.

Observation:

  • Three children developed symptoms consistent with infantile autism during an acute encephalopathic illness.
  • One child showed elevated herpes simplex virus titers and temporal lobe lesions on CT scan.
  • The autistic syndrome was reversible and distinct from acquired epileptic aphasia.

Findings:

  • The cases demonstrate an acquired and reversible autistic syndrome in childhood.
  • Clinical similarities were noted to bilateral medial temporal lobe disease and the Klüver-Bucy syndrome.
  • Etiology was identified in one case (herpes simplex virus) but remained undefined in others.

Implications:

  • These findings suggest that acute medial temporal lobe insults can lead to reversible autistic syndromes.
  • Highlights the importance of considering acquired neurological conditions in the differential diagnosis of childhood autism.
  • Further research into the neurobiological mechanisms of autism and its potential reversibility is warranted.
